Understanding IPv4 Leasing: A Comprehensive Guide
IPv4 IP assignment is a important mechanism utilized in network management to automatically provide IP addresses to devices. This method allows a scarce pool of IPv4 space to be efficiently distributed among a broader collection of attached systems. Essentially, leasing entails assigning an IP number for a defined period, after which it becomes open for re-use to another machine. This stops permanent assignment and fosters better utilization of the dwindling IPv4 space. The period of a lease can be set by the network operator and impacts the periodicity of IP renewal processes.

IP Version 4 Rental Assignment: A Step-by-Step Walkthrough
To start setting up IPv4 dynamic addresses on your LAN , proceed with these simple steps. Initially, navigate to your DHCP server’s management console. Next, locate the area dedicated to IP address distribution. You will often see options for rental duration; choose a suitable interval – commonly between click here the day and a week. Don't omit to define the range of addresses to be allocated. Finally, submit your changes and confirm that recently addresses are being distributed correctly to your networked devices . This process ensures efficient internet protocol address management within your network .
Troubleshooting Common Issues in IPv4 Leasing Systems
Diagnosing problems with IPv4 assignment systems often requires investigating several common causes . A primary obstacle can be conflicts in the DHCP server 's pool, leading to address overlaps . Additionally, improperly configured switches can hinder clients from obtaining usable IP addresses . Ultimately, ensure system connectivity between clients and the IP server is vital for reliable operation; data loss can quickly disrupt the assignment process .
